Update on Limited Representations: "Unbundling" Discrete Legal Tasks

As a follow-up to our posts here and here on "unbundling" and various states' movements toward limited representations, consider this ABA Journal eReport story on the Massachusetts pilot project for 201392_63340356family courts we previously noted here.  The Louisville, Kentucky blogger Divorce Law Journal urges here that her state consider such a status, especially in divorce court:  "Sounds like a promising solution to the courts being overwhelmed with unrepresented litigants," she writes.  [Alan Childress]
